We have been staying in and around Cavelossim for over 30 years (bar the Covid Years). We have stayed here before and have known the family and most of their staff for a long time. We have been absent from Goa since Covid and returned this year in the hopes that it was still as good as it had been, it isn't... it's even better!!. What really makes Sao Domingos is the "feel". It's very much like being part of it, being at home with it. Everyone from Edwin the owner, down to the lads who look after the rooms are just excellent, friendly easy to talk to and certainly give the impression that they are because they want to. The rooms may be bit basic, but very comfortable, but that's a reflection of the cost, it's what you should expect, and if you don't agree go across the road to one of the more expensive hotels at five times the cost, where you will find colourful Indian weddings every week whic may exclude you from the hotel facilities. The rooms are cleaned, towels replaced etc every day, and if you have any small issues just ask, 99 times out of a hundred it will soon be resolved. It's a bit of a venue for expats and mostly of a slightly senior nature, and though we usually avoid expat communities when away it has to be said that it just works her. The majority are returnees and though it has been five years since last we came, there were lots of clients and staff who we immediately recognised. There's live music which though a little noisy sometimes ceases around 11pm. I would like to mention and thank so many people working here individually by name but this review is already too long so I won't . I will mention Hazel on reception who has such great organisational skills, thank you. The accompanying restaurant, Goan Village is also excellent but perhaps a separate review is needed for that. This year was an excellent 3 weeks, wish we had booked for four, but now we have for next year. Thanks
